Ticket: Staging env misconfigured for Siftgate bloom filter

The bloom layer in front of the Pellet KV store is rejecting all lookups in staging because the env file was copied from the dev template without credentials. False-positive tuning values are fine; only the auth line is missing. To unblock the weekly demo, the Pellet admission secret must be set on the following line.

env line for yaguf-fajop: LEDGER_TOKEN13=fb08984397349

Hi all,

Quick heads-up from the front desk: our landlord, Merrowgate Estates, is running a site audit at Calder Yard this Thursday and Friday. If you're a contractor coming in on those days, please allow extra time — their inspectors will be walking the floors and the loading bay may close briefly without notice. Keep hi-vis on in shared areas and sign in as usual at the desk. For the contractor entrance on the east side, use the code below.

Thanks,
Front desk

door code, hahag-yajef: bdg-HJOPW-2

Runbook: Proctoring queue stall (Examline). If the invigilator queue backs up past 15 minutes, don't restart the workers blindly — drain first, or sessions get orphaned mid-exam. Scale consumers up, confirm lag drops, then scale back after the exam window. Before touching anything, sanity-check the live queue settings, which are as follows.

service settings:
[silwyn]
host = silwyn.crelvogrid.internal
user = silwyn_svc
database = silwyn_prod